Job Summary
Respiratory Therapist Registered (RRT) Position located in the NICU. This role involves providing specialized respiratory care in a neonatal intensive care unit setting, working with a multidisciplinary team to ensure optimal patient outcomes. The position requires flexibility to work rotating shifts over a specified contract period.
Job Details
- Position Description: Locum NICU Respiratory Therapist
- Certifications, Education Requirements, Degree Requirements, Location Requirements, and Years of Experience: 1 year of experience as a Respiratory Therapist Registered (RRT) with a valid credential.
- Schedule: Rotating shifts, 12 hours per shift, with a minimum of 36 hours per week.
- Additional Information: The role involves working in a neonatal intensive care unit environment, providing respiratory therapy interventions for neonatal patients. Submission of relevant credentials and licensure documentation is required for consideration.

About Grand Forks, ND
As a Travel Registered Respiratory Therapist in Grand Forks, ND here's what you should know:- L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
- Wages may be slightly lower to match the lower cost of living.
- Average summer highs of 80°F and lows of 55°F.
- Winter highs average around 20°F with lows around 0°F.
- Short term rentals are available but may be limited.
- It's recommended to start the search early to secure suitable options.
- Car friendliness is high, with easy navigation and ample parking.
- Public transportation options are limited.
- The population is relatively diverse, with a mix of age ranges.
- Common health issues may include seasonal affective disorder due to the long winters.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ses in the area.
- Grand Forks offers a variety of restaurants, especially with a focus on local cuisine.
- There are art galleries, music venues, and sports events.
-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y parks, hiking, and water activities on the nearby Red River.
